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: High-quality materials may cost more but provide better durability.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ates can vary, impacting the total expense.
- Site Preparation: The complexity of site preparation, including excavation and grading, can affect costs.
- Pad Size: Larger foundation pads require more materials and labor, increasing the cost.
- Soil Condition: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ional work and materials.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for permits and required inspections can add to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ay construction and increase labor cost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Kernersville, NC)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Excavation | $500 - $2,500 |
Concrete Pouring |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Reinforcement Materials | $1,200 - $3,000 |
Labor |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$500 |
Total Estimated Cost | $7,900 - $21,000 |
